The machining market encompasses a wide array of precision cutting, shaping, and finishing processes used to manufacture complex metal and composite parts for industries such as automotive, aerospace, energy, and medical devices. Machining products include CNC (computer numerical control) machines, lathes, milling machines, grinders, and machining centers, all designed to deliver high dimensional accuracy and repeatability. Advantages of modern machining technologies include reduced cycle times, lowered tooling costs, enhanced surface finishes, and the ability to work with hard-to-machine materials like titanium and high-strength alloys.

Machining Market is witnessing few key trends such as growing adoption of computer numerical controlled (CNC) machines, rising demand for multi-tasking machines, and growing popularity of hybrid machining processes. As product lifecycles shorten and customization demands rise, manufacturers increasingly rely on flexible machining solutions that integrate with automation systems, IoT-enabled monitoring, and advanced tooling. The need for lightweight, high-performance components in electric vehicles and renewable energy equipment further propels adoption of multi-axis and high-speed machining platforms. These systems not only boost productivity but also support sustainable manufacturing by optimizing material usage and minimizing waste.

According to CoherentMI, The machining market is estimated to be valued at USD 429.53 Bn in 2025 and is expected to reach USD 676.31 Bn by 2032, growing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.7% from 2025 to 2032.



The growing demand for machined components is driven by rapid expansion in electric vehicle production, renewable energy installations, and medical device manufacturing. Automakers require lightweight, high-strength parts such as battery housings, motor components, and chassis elements, increasing demand for multi-axis milling and turning centers. In the renewable energy sector, wind turbine manufacturers seek large-scale machining solutions capable of handling oversized components with tight tolerances. The medical industry’s transition to personalized implants and surgical tools further drives need for five-axis machining centers and micro-machining equipment.
